A Day in the Life of a Media Search Analyst :

  • Perform comprehensive assessments of diverse task categories, including music, books, podcasts, video, and home pod evaluations across various media domains.
  • Analyze and evaluate search outcomes for App Store content, conduct online research to assess and validate query accuracy and intent, and apply market expertise to evaluate the relevance and purpose of task‑related information for your specific market.
